Ethiopia is one of the only places where coffee grows wild. Approximately 85% of Ethiopia’s coffee is produced by small farmers on less than 1 hectare of land. They use traditional practices for fertilization and pest control that are organic in nature but generally lack the Organic certification because of barriers related to cost and infrastructure.

The Sidama Coffee Farmers’ Cooperative Union (SCFCU) was founded in 2001 to represent coffee producing cooperatives located throughout the Sidama Zone of Southern Ethiopia. As of 2013, the SCFCU has grown to represent 46 cooperatives making the SCFCU the second largest coffee producing cooperative union in Ethiopia.

This a certified organic Ethiopian Washed Sidamo Shoye FT is sourced from family-owned farms organized around the Shoye Cooperative located within the Dale district. It is produced from indigenous heirloom cultivars and exhibits notes of lemongrass, black tea and peach.
